Definition and Purpose of the Medical Report

The "ROYAL EMBASSY OF SAUDI ARABIA IN PARIS MEDICAL REPORT - dsachs" serves as an official document required for specific purposes by the embassy. This form is likely used to verify the medical history and current health status of individuals in the context of visa applications or residency confirmations. It includes a comprehensive assessment of an applicant's health to ensure they meet the necessary medical standards set by the consulate.

Core Components of the Medical Report

  • Applicant Information: Includes personal details such as name, date of birth, and passport number to ensure accurate identification.
  • Medical Examination Details: Comprehensive health check sections covering general health, specific tests like TB and Hepatitis screening, and any pertinent medical history.
  • Certified Medical Practitioner’s Statement: A detailed section for a licensed physician to document findings, assessments, and their professional endorsement.
  • Signature and Date: Final sign-off from both the applicant and the examining physician to confirm the authenticity and timeliness of the information provided.

Why Obtain the Medical Report

Obtaining this particular medical report is crucial for several reasons, predominantly tied to health validation for visa or residency applications.

  • Medical Verification: Confirms that applicants are free from contagious diseases and are generally in good health, a requirement for entry into Saudi Arabia.
  • Compliance with Immigration Regulations: Ensures applicants meet the health standards set forth by the Saudi government, assisting in a smoother application process.
  • Preventing Public Health Risks: Helps authorities maintain control over potential health issues that might arise from international visitors.
